Can Smart Pix Manager find duplicate images on my computer even if they have different filenames???

Smart Pix Manager will automatically detect and warn you when you try to add a file to your library that is the same as one that already exists (it checks the content of the file, so it does not matter if the filename is different).

This functionality is controlled by the "Check for Duplicates" option under Tools > Options, Media Library.


You can also do this manually by selecting Library > Find Duplicate Files.
